National Geographic: Rarely Seen
In this exhibition of visual wonders, National Geographic reveals a world very few have the chance to see for themselves. The exhibition at Bally's Las Vegas features 50 striking images shot by some of the world’s finest photographers of places, events, natural phenomena, and man-made heirlooms seldom seen by human eyes. Open daily from 10 a.m. to 8 p.m. Advanced reservations encouraged. Tickets $35 for adults and $22 for children.

For a cause: Nevada SPCA and Bad Beat Brewing team up
You can now drink beer and save homeless pets in our community at the same time! Nevada SPCA is collaborating with local brewery, Bad Beat Brewing, to release a special, limited-edition beer aptly named “Best Furiend Brew." The new brew will be released on Saturday, April 2 during a special adoption event hosted at Bad Beat Brewing. During the event, Bad Beat Brewing will donate $1 from every pint of Best Furiend Brew poured and $2 from every four-pack purchased. A dollar from any of the twelve beers on tap purchased during this event will also be donated to Nevada SPCA. Adoptable pets will be on-site along with a local food truck vendor. The family- and dog-friendly event happens from noon to 4 p.m. at 7380 Eastgate Road, Suite 110 in Henderson.
